Web5 jul. 2024 · To remove this type of stain from concrete: Pour one-eighth of a cup of liquid dishwashing detergent into a spray bottle, then top off the bottle with warm water and shake well. Spray the concrete stains with the soap solution, let it sit for 10 minutes, and then scrub with a stiff nylon brush.

Web7 jan. 2024 · Note: One method of removing oil stains that you will find on the internet is the use of muriatic acid. Do not do this! Muriatic acid is used to profile concrete by breaking down the surface for application of coatings and sealers. Minwax is KNOWN for their high VOC content and the "it takes forever to remove the smell" issue. This is Minwax's trademark. We've seen Minwax stain (doors, trim and flooring) take several weeks/months to reduce odour.
